In a bold move to empower young entrepreneurs and stimulate economic growth, the Oyo State Government, through the State Agency for Youth Development, has launched a pioneering initiative to support the development of youth-led businesses.

The initiative, which was unveiled during a visit to two prominent business training centers in Ibadan, aims to provide young entrepreneurs with the skills, expertise, and resources required to succeed in today’s fast-paced business landscape.

According to Prince Falana Adebowale, Chairman of the Oyo State Agency for Youth Development, the initiative is designed to identify, nurture, and support young entrepreneurs who have the potential to drive innovation and economic growth in the state.

He said the agency aims to empower these individuals by providing the necessary training and support that will enable them to thrive in today’s competitive business landscape.

According to him, “Our goal is to create a vibrant entrepreneurial ecosystem that supports the growth and development of youth-led businesses; we believe that by empowering young entrepreneurs, we can unlock the full potential of our state and create a brighter future for our citizens.”

However, the initiative has received widespread support from stakeholders, including business leaders, entrepreneurs, and community organizations.

In their separate reaction, at one of the business training centers visited by the delegation, Mr. Timothy Ayodele, the owner of Sheda(“Create”), in Joyful Mood acknowledged that this is a welcome development for Pacesetter State entrepreneurs.

“We showcased an open business specializing in web development, coding, app creation, photography, and video editing. Our program is designed to assess and enhance the capacity, expertise, and staff strength of young entrepreneurs

“We are excited to partner with the Oyo State Agency for Youth Development to support the growth and development of young entrepreneurs.”

Also, the Ibadan Incubation Hub is managed by Mrs. Oyenike A. Adeleke, who also serves as the convener of the Ibadan Entrepreneurs Network; reaffirmed that The Hub is dedicated to identifying, training, mentoring, and promoting the mental well-being of entrepreneurs through comprehensive coaching and advocacy initiatives.

The Oyo State Agency for Youth Development has pledged to continue working tirelessly to support the development of young entrepreneurs and stimulate economic growth in the state.

By providing young entrepreneurs with the skills, expertise, and resources required to succeed, the agency is confident that it can make a positive impact on the state’s economy and create a brighter future for its citizens.
